With its own Civil War history, the Braehead Manor is the perfect place to stay when you're touring northern Virginia battlefields. We enjoyed breakfast in the dining room where Gen. Lee ate on the morning of the Battle of Fredericksburg and stood under the tree where he tied his horse, Traveller. It's an easy drive to several battlefields--including Fredericksburg, Chancellorsville, Wilderness and Spotsylvania Courthouse.
